The first of 130 former Starbucks coffee shops resuming business in Russia under the name Stars Coffee opened its doors in Moscow.

The new owners plan to open 90 Stars Coffee shops in Moscow, 15 in St. Petersburg and 15 in other locations, RBK— replacing the 130 Starbucks that had been in operation in Russia before the chain left in a mass exodus of Western companies including Adidas, H&M, Ikea, Little Caesars, McDonald’s and Nike.
